"Summertime of Our Lives" is a song by British-Norwegian boy band A1. It was released on 30 August 1999 as the second single from their debut studio album, Here We Come (1999). The single was released on 30 August 1999 and peaked at No. 5 on the UK Singles Chart.

Chart (1999–2000) | Peak position |
---|---|
Australia ( ARIA) [5] | 44 |
Europe ( Eurochart Hot 100) [6] | 25 |
Iceland ( Íslenski Listinn Topp 40) [7] | 39 |
New Zealand ( Recorded Music NZ) [8] | 22 |
Scotland ( OCC) [9] | 6 |
UK Singles ( OCC) [10] | 5 |
